Transaction 5a0675130bcd95f1a84a066c0d8c492f3bd5182c205b2101d1feb2c69aabfcf5
1 Input
1 Output
-
5a0675130bcd95f1a84a066c0d8c492f3bd5182c205b2101d1feb2c69aabfcf5:0
- value
- 158863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 223812d5f47f12b711503252126b02247c497f42 OP_EQUAL
- address
- 34ox58HaUP5tHHQF9t8ygrCuqzTAwyhZCF